2021 Mid-Year Demo

Mystik-Metamorphosis Halfway through the year already! I have been on a production tear lately. Mostly trying to learn my gear really well. Lately it's been using the Synthstrom Deluge since I'm about to go on a roadtrip and want to feel comfortable with just that. Before that, it was with the Akai Force and using that to aggregate and compose with a DSI Tempest, the aforementioned Deluge, Korg Electribe 2 and ER-1, Yamaha RM1X, Roland VT-3 and Yamaha CS as primary sound generators and a Pioneer RMX-1000 as a master effect. Performing Rights Organizations vs Distributors

Ok, so one of my band's Mystik Luminate have just been asked to register for either ASCAP or BMI in order for our label manager to register us for our latest release's performance royalties. This is leading me & my brother to start discussing & investigating which performing rights organization (or PRO) to use... BMI is free, where as ASCAP has a $50 fee for songwriting & also for publishing...
